Understanding Toyota’s Hybrid Technology
Toyota revolutionized the auto industry with the launch of the Prius in 1997, introducing hybrid technology to the mainstream. This milestone marked the beginning of a global shift toward fuel-efficient and environmentally conscious vehicles. Over the years, Toyota has continually improved its hybrid systems, culminating in the sophisticated Hybrid Synergy Drive (HSD) technology that powers its current toyota hybrid suv lineup. This system seamlessly blends electric and gasoline power to optimize fuel efficiency and performance.
The hybrid journey for Toyota didn’t stop with the Prius. The automaker expanded its hybrid offerings to include toyota hybrid suv models, sedans, and even minivans, recognizing the growing demand for eco-friendly vehicles in all categories. The integration of hybrid systems into SUVs allowed consumers to enjoy the power and utility of a traditional SUV while minimizing their environmental footprint with a toyota hybrid suv.
How Toyota Hybrid Systems Work
At the core of every toyota hybrid suv is the ability to switch between electric power, gasoline power, or a combination of both. This is achieved through components like the electric motor, battery pack, and an internal combustion engine, all managed by a sophisticated energy management system. One of the standout features of a toyota hybrid suv is regenerative braking, which recaptures energy during deceleration and stores it in the battery for later use.
This efficient energy management leads to a smoother driving experience and significant fuel savings over time. Toyota’s full hybrid systems are designed to operate in electric-only mode at low speeds, reducing fuel use in stop-and-go traffic. As a result, toyota hybrid suv owners benefit from both performance and economy without having to plug in their vehicles.

Lineup of Toyota Hybrid SUVs
The RAV4 Hybrid is one of the most popular toyota hybrid suv options, blending practicality, fuel efficiency, and sporty styling. It features a 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engine paired with an electric motor to deliver a combined 219 horsepower. With an EPA-estimated 40 mpg combined, this toyota hybrid suv is perfect for commuters and adventure seekers alike.
Inside, the RAV4 Hybrid offers a spacious and tech-rich cabin, including standard features like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, and Toyota Safety Sense. Its cargo capacity rivals many larger SUVs, making it a great toyota hybrid suv option for families. The RAV4 Hybrid also comes with an available all-wheel-drive system, providing added confidence on slippery roads.
Toyota Highlander Hybrid
The Highlander Hybrid is designed for families needing more room and comfort in their toyota hybrid suv. It seats up to eight passengers and provides ample cargo space. Powered by a 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engine and two electric motors, it delivers 243 horsepower and an estimated 36 mpg combined—excellent for a midsize toyota hybrid suv.
The Highlander Hybrid offers a quiet, smooth ride and a well-appointed interior with premium materials. Advanced safety features come standard, and the infotainment system includes a large touchscreen and intuitive controls. With its balance of size, efficiency, and comfort, the Highlander is a standout toyota hybrid suv for growing families.
Toyota Venza
The Venza re-entered Toyota’s lineup as a stylish midsize crossover with a standard hybrid powertrain, securing its place as a sleek toyota hybrid suv. It uses the same 2.5-liter engine as the RAV4 Hybrid, delivering a combined 219 horsepower and around 39 mpg. The Venza stands out with its elegant design, upscale interior, and quiet ride quality, adding a luxurious option to the toyota hybrid suv segment.
Inside, the Venza offers a near-luxury experience with soft-touch materials, ambient lighting, and an optional panoramic sunroof. It’s ideal for buyers who prioritize comfort and efficiency in a toyota hybrid suv. The Venza comes standard with all-wheel drive, making it a versatile choice within the toyota hybrid suv family.
Toyota Grand Highlander Hybrid
The Grand Highlander Hybrid is Toyota’s answer to those needing more space than the regular Highlander. It offers three rows of seating with additional legroom and cargo capacity, making it a larger toyota hybrid suv option. The hybrid version features a turbocharged engine paired with electric motors for a robust yet efficient performance.
This toyota hybrid suv offers premium features like a 12.3-inch touchscreen, advanced driver assistance systems, and generous passenger comfort. With up to 34 mpg combined, it’s an excellent choice for larger families or those who frequently travel with passengers and gear, all while driving a reliable toyota hybrid suv.
Toyota Sequoia Hybrid (i-FORCE MAX)
The Sequoia Hybrid represents Toyota’s full-size SUV category with a bold move toward electrification. The i-FORCE MAX hybrid system pairs a twin-turbo V6 engine with an electric motor, delivering an impressive 437 horsepower. It’s designed for heavy-duty tasks such as towing and off-roading, making it a unique contender in the toyota hybrid suv market.
With a towing capacity of up to 9,000 pounds and a refined cabin filled with tech and luxury touches, this toyota hybrid suv proves you don’t have to sacrifice power or capability for efficiency. It’s ideal for those seeking a large, rugged SUV with the benefits of hybrid technology, wrapped in a dependable toyota hybrid suv.
